Post by ⓣⓡⓘⓒⓚⓨ48 on Sept 5, 2019 23:44:12 GMT -5
deputy666 just press this button and it will lock onto current target (disabling auto target until you turn too far away from it and loose your lock). Press again and it will cycle to the next target within a certain cone around the direction you are looking. Its not perfect... but it’s vital to being choosy with your targets. IMO YMMV

You need to find some friends on facebook who also have the game linked to their facebook. Both of you have to play on the same version of the game (Facebook gameroom) as you can't play with people on ios, android etc. You can't even friend people on steam who use the same server.
